Callan Saldutto

  • Position Throws
  • Class Junior
  • Hometown Toronto, Ontario
  • Highschool Notre Dame College School

HONORS
2023 First-Team All-Sun Belt Conference Outdoor Track & Field
2021 Second-Team All-Sun Belt Conference Outdoor Track & Field
 
2023 OUTDOOR (JUNIOR)
Competed in four meets, throwing only the javelin … Qualified for the NCAA East Regional Preliminaries (May 25) in the javelin, throwing 189-7 (57.78 meters) to finish in 46th … First-Team All-Sun Belt Conference after winning the javelin with a personal-best heave of 241-8 (73.67 meters) at the SBC Outdoor Track & Field Championships (May 11) … Won the javelin with a throw of 210-3 (64.09 meters) at the Warhawk Classic (April 22) … Returned to action at the Clyde Littlefield Texas Relays, finishing 13th in the javelin with a throw of 227-9 (69.41 meters).
 
2023 INDOOR (JUNIOR)
Did not compete.
 
2022 OUTDOOR (SOPHOMORE)
Competed in one outdoor meet, taking ninth in the javelin at 219-9 at the Clyde Littlefield Texas Relays (March 23-26).

2022 INDOOR (SOPHOMORE)
Competed in three indoor meets … Set a personal best in the weight throw at 53-6 1/2 to place seventh at the Sun Belt Conference Indoor Championships (Feb. 21-22) … Placed sixth in the weight throw at 51-11 at the Ted Nelson Invitational (Jan. 14).

SUMMER 2021
Competed at the World Athletics U20 Championships in Nairobi, Kenya, representing Canada in the javelin.

2021 OUTDOOR (FRESHMAN)
Qualified for the NCAA East Regional Preliminaries (May 26) in the javelin, where he threw 195-2 (59.49 meters) to place 44th … Second-Team All-Sun Belt Conference after closing out the 2021 Sun Belt Outdoor Championship (May 13) with a second-place finish in the javelin (229-feet, 3-inches / 69.88 meters) and a 14th-place outing in the hammer throw (160-feet, 8-inches / 48.98 meters) … Had two Top-10 finishes in the hammer throw, finished seventh in the Louisiana Classics (45.88 meters) and fourth at the Leon Johnson Northwestern State Invitational (47.70 meters) … had five Top-10 finishes in the javelin event … earned first in the javelin at the Clyde Littlefield Texas Relays (69.46 meters) … claimed second at the Louisiana Classics (59.73) in the javelin … was third at both the LSU Boots Garland Invitational (58.51 meters) and the Leon Johnson Northwestern State Invitational (58.91 meters).
 
2021 OUTDOOR (FRESHMAN)
Made his collegiate debut in the weight throw event at the LSU Purple Tiger (Jan. 16), wrapping up the event in 10th after a toss of 13.07 meters … enjoyed his best finish of the indoor regular season, sixth, at the LSU Louisiana Invitational (Jan. 29) with a toss of 14.48 meters … came through with a seventh-place finish at the USA Jaguar Invitational (Feb. 7) after reaching a distance of 15.21 meters … closed out the indoor slate by placing eighth in the weight throw event of the Sun Belt Indoor Championship (Feb. 22), reaching 15.50 meters.

NOTRE DAME COLLEGE SCHOOL
Had senior season in 2020 canceled due to COVID-19…Competed in meets after high school, throwing 61.39 meters in the javelin and 49.78 meters in the discus…As a junior in 2019, he placed sixth in the shot put (15.62 meters), ninth in the discus (46.58 meters, 1.6 kilograms) and 17th in javelin (53.57 meters, 800 grams) at the OFSAA Provincial Championships…As a sophomore in 2018, he placed second in the discus (60.91 meters, 1 kilogram), third in the javelin (55.39 meters, 600 grams) and third in the shot put (16.36, 4 kilograms) at the OFSAA Provincial Championships…As a freshman in 2017, he placed first in the discus (58.48 meters, 1 kilogram), seventh in the javelin (44.54 meters, 600 grams) and 12th in the 100 meter hurdles (15.32 seconds) at the OFSAA Provincial Championships…Also played football, helping his team to a second place finish in the province and was named MVP as a sophomore…Top Scholar Award each semester of high school.
